What's The Definition Of Sunlight?
[n] the rays of the sun; "the shingles were weathered by the sun and wind"
Synonyms | Synonyms for Sunlight: sun | sunshine Related Terms | Find terms related to Sunlight: See Also | light | sunbeam | sunray | visible light | visible radiation Sunlight In Webster's Dictionary \Sun"light`\, n.
The light of the sun. --Milton.
